6. Turn the computer right side up and open the display panel.
7. Insert a thin object under the rim of the keyboard brace and lift it out.
8. Remove two screws securing the keyboard.
9. Lift up the back of the keyboard, rotate it toward you and lay in face
down on the palm rest.
Figure 2: Removing the keyboard brace and two screws
10.Remove one screw securing the keyboard support plate, lift the plate up
and out to remove it.
11.Disconnect the keyboard flexible cable from the connector and remove
the keyboard.
Figure 3: Removing the keyboard support plate and the keyboard
When you move the keyboard forward, do not touch the keys. Doing so
could cause misalignment. Hold the keyboard by the sides and lay it
gently on the palm rest. The keyboard is connected to the computer by the
keyboard flexible cable. Be careful not to apply tension to this cable when
you lift up the keyboard.
